Abstract
Next Generation Network (NGN) is regarded as service driven network. The flexibility and agility of deploying new service is increasingly becoming the focus of communication industry today. It is important to learn the success experiences of existed service provision and service development technologies from telecommunication industry and introduce the new service integration technologies of SOA from IT industry. Firstly, the paper summarized the characteristic of SOA and researched the element and cooperation of SOA. Secondly, it explored how to build a SOA based services integration architecture for convergent network. Finally, the service integration solution for the NGN is proposed. It based on two strategic tenets. First, it makes use of the IMS plane and the Web services realization mechanism as backbone for integrating service. Secondly, it uses Web services to automate the entire lifecycle of service, which in turn allows third party application providers to deploy services by using the services exposed by network provider.
